'use strict';
// Example secrets configuration for the theta42/proxy.
//
// The proxy is an OIDC client of an SSO Manager (or any OIDC provider) AND a
// direct LDAP client for user lookups. This file supplies that wiring.
//
// Docker / unified stack: place at ./config/proxy-secrets.js and bind-mount
// ./config at /config (see docker-compose.yml); docker-entrypoint.sh points the
// CONF_SECRETS env var at it so @simpleworkjs/conf reads it. No app_* env
// should be passed — app_* env beats this file in @simpleworkjs/conf, so the
// file is authoritative only if the matching app_* env is absent.
//
// Bare-metal: ops/install.sh seeds this file at /etc/proxy/secrets.js on first
// run (with placeholders for the values it can't guess) and points the
// systemd unit's CONF_SECRETS env var at it. Fill in your values, then
// `sudo systemctl restart proxy`. Values here override conf/base.js and win
// over <environment>.js.
//
// Only the keys the app reads are listed below. The `stack` key is read by the
// theta-env orchestrator (setup.sh) and ignored by the app.
module.exports = {
name: 'Dynamic Proxy', // shown in the UI
logo: '/static/img/theta42.svg', // nav image; point at your own file under public/ to white-label
// OpenID Connect — point at your SSO Manager. Issuer + authorization/
// endSession are browser-facing URLs; token/userinfo can be the internal
// URL if the SSO is on the same docker network (avoids a TLS hairpin).
oidc: {
enabled: true,
issuer: 'https://sso.example.com',
authorizationEndpoint: 'https://sso.example.com/oauth/authorize',
tokenEndpoint: 'http://sso-manager:3001/oauth/token',
userinfoEndpoint: 'http://sso-manager:3001/oauth/userinfo',
endSessionEndpoint: 'https://sso.example.com/oauth/logout',
clientId: '391136c8-9631-47c4-aac6-d6b760b7a9ae', // registered on the SSO
clientSecret: 'b29cce9c-de0c-4acc-b76a-494168f0381d', // from the SSO client record
redirectUri: 'https://proxy.example.com/api/auth/oidc/callback',
scopes: ['openid', 'profile', 'email', 'groups'],
groupsClaim: 'groups',
usernameClaim: 'preferred_username',
},
// Direct LDAP user lookups. ldaps:// + rejectUnauthorized:false for a
// self-signed cert (the SSO's default), or set tlsOptions.ca to a CA path
// for strict verification. bindPassword MUST match the
// serviceAccountPass in the SSO's sso-secrets.js (the proxy binds as that
// service account).
ldap: {
url: 'ldaps://sso-manager:636',
bindDN: 'cn=ldapclient,ou=people,dc=example,dc=com',
bindPassword: 'proxy-service-pass',
searchBase: 'ou=people,dc=example,dc=com',
userFilter: '(objectClass=inetOrgPerson)',
userNameAttribute: 'uid',
tlsOptions: {
rejectUnauthorized: false, // true + ca for a CA-signed cert
},
},
// Authorization. adminUsers is the local anti-lockout admin (matches
// auth.adminUsers in conf/base.js). adminGroups: SSO/LDAP groups whose
// members are always global admins.
auth: {
adminGroups: [],
adminUsers: ['proxyadmin'],
groupRoleMap: {},
// Optional: the local anti-lockout admin's initial password, used
// ONLY the first time that account is created. Leave unset and it
// defaults to the username itself ("proxyadmin2") — fine for a quick
// local test, but change it (or set this) before exposing the proxy
// publicly. Once the account exists, this key is never read again;
// change the password via the app itself (or delete the Redis user
// to force it to be re-bootstrapped with a new value here).
localAdminPass: 'proxyadmin-test-pass',
},
// ── Orchestrator-only (ignored by the app) ───────────────────────────────
// Read by the theta-env setup.sh (e.g. to seed the OAuth client). Omit for
// bare-metal use.
stack: {
ssoHost: 'sso.example.com', // public SSO hostname
proxyHost: 'proxy.example.com', // public proxy hostname
},
};
